Travel and Food Discounts

The AARP is a veritable gold mine for seniors looking to save money. In the realm of travel, AARP has partnered with esteemed car rental companies such as Avis and Budget, which offer members up to 30% off on rentals. That’s a substantial saving, especially for those with a penchant for road trips.

But the travel benefits don’t stop at car rentals. AARP members enjoy exclusive deals with airlines like British Airways, making international travel more affordable. Hotel chains like Hilton and Wyndham also offer discounts of up to 20% to AARP members, making your stay not just comfortable, but budget-friendly too.

And for the foodies, an AARP membership brings discounts at popular restaurants like Outback Steakhouse and Denny’s, making your dining experiences more enjoyable and lighter on the wallet.

If you’re looking to travel local instead, National parks across the U.S. are another great source of savings. They offer a lifetime pass for seniors at a significantly reduced rate, allowing unlimited access to the country’s beautiful and diverse natural landscapes.

Insurance Discounts

Insurance is another area where AARP members can benefit. Companies like The Hartford offer special rates exclusively for AARP members, easing the financial burden of insurance premiums. And, for those concerned about home security, AARP has you covered too. They’ve partnered with companies such as ADT to offer discounts on home security systems.

Health and Wellness Discounts

AARP’s benefits extend beyond lifestyle and entertainment. They’ve thoughtfully curated discounts in health and wellness, which can be a major area of expenditure for many seniors. In association with Walgreens, AARP offers discounts on prescription medications, making necessary healthcare more affordable.

Vision care, another essential aspect of health for seniors, also becomes more budget-friendly with AARP. They’ve partnered with LensCrafters to offer discounts on eye care, including glasses and contact lenses. Fitness enthusiasts aren’t left out either. AARP’s fitness program, in collaboration with Tivity Health, provides discounted gym memberships and fitness classes, allowing you to stay fit and healthy without straining your finances.

Retail Discounts

While AARP offers a magnificent array of discounts, there are other avenues where seniors can save. Retailers like Kohl’s offer a 15% discount to customers aged 60 and over every Wednesday. Such deals can make shopping for clothes, home goods, and other items substantially more affordable.

Technology Discounts

Seniors with a knack for technology aren’t left out of the discount party either. Telecommunication giants like AT&T and Verizon offer senior-specific plans that provide significant savings compared to standard plans. These plans not only offer better pricing, but they’re also designed with seniors in mind.

They often come with features like larger text options and easy-to-navigate menus, making it a breeze to stay connected with friends and family. Even tech companies like Apple and Microsoft offer senior discounts on some of their products. This makes it more affordable to stay updated with the latest gadgets and software, ensuring you’re not left behind in the digital age.
